Are you familiar with the phrase ‘walking wounded’? This refers to those who are injured but still upright and functional. My servant Jacob lived before this was a common phrase, but he was a prime example. After his encounter with me he walked with a limp the rest of his life. How many do you know who are in the same condition? What about yourself? Even if you walk normally you may have in a larger sense some weakness that you have to deal with as a constant reminder of your frailty. If you examine yourself and your fellow believers you will see this is quite common. Even Paul had a thorn in his flesh I declined to remove. I told him that my grace was sufficient for him and it is for you too.
